I just acquired a model 20/26 that is drilled and tapped for a side mount (4 holes) could someone tell me what mounts where used for this gun.

Probably an older Weaver, but could too be a Pachmayr. I don't know the model but you might find it in in Nick Strobel's book on old scopes. On second thought, I doubt Pachmayr ever made a mount for the 20.
Might want to post a picture and measurements of the spacing of the holes also. Might have had a "creative" gunsmith modify a mount to fit.
According to the old catalogs the Weaver Q1, N1 or N4 are for the model 20.

The hole space is left to right 3 1/16.
The first to second hole is 11/16.
The second to third is 1 11/16.
The third to forth is 11/16.

That is Weaver hole spacing.

I think the Weaver "Side Mount" with a #1 base (for 1" scope) might work. I don't think the "N" mount (3/4" scope) will work. Note: the upper part of the bolt handle might hit the scope when open if it has not been altered already.
